On 3/27/2024 10:14 AM, John Dallman wrote:
> In article <uu188n$2s5jm$4@dont-email.me>,
> clubley@remove_me.eisner.decus.org-Earth.UFP (Simon Clubley) wrote:
>
>> Linux isn't perfect in this regard either.
>>
>> The earliest "fun" I remember in this area was the move from the
>> .so.5 version of the C++ (not C) ABI to the .so.6 version.
>
> Yup. The .so.X scheme is for version numbers of the library's ABI. Enough
> people fooled themselves that was adequate for the .5 to .6 change to
> cause serious difficulties.
>
> It's notable that the GCC and glibc projects responded with the "version
> every signature change of each symbol" they use now, meaning that the
> .so.6 version of the C++ ABI is likely to continue forever. However, this
> (a) requires scrupulous attention to detail and (b) requires an OS with
> symbol versioning support built into the linker, loader, etc.

For those very interested in details:
https://www.cs.dartmouth.edu/~sergey/cs258/ABI/UlrichDrepper-How-To-Write-Shared-Libraries.pdf
